Where does “peliala” come from?

peliala (Finnish) comes from Finnish peli, from Middle Low German spel, from Old Saxon spil, from Proto-West Germanic spil — dance; game, exercise.

peliala (Finnish): gaming industry, gaming sector

Definitions

  1. gaming industry, gaming sector
